Group C: Chord Voicings

In this lesson, we will explore various types of chord voicings against the three types of seventh chords, similar to the arpeggios. However, we will be strumming them as chords.

B Major 7

  • First shape: B major 7

  • Voice: We might have to fingerpick these, as they've been voiced in the book.

    Count: 1, 2, 3, 4

  • Note: Really nice chord!

  • Alternative Voicing:

    • If we wanted to play it on the A string, we'd have this voicing here.

C Minor 7

  • Next, let's have a look at the minor seven voicing.

  • Position: Third fret

  • Shape: C minor 7

  • Alternative Voicing:

    • If we want that same chord with the root notes on the E string, we'll move up to the 8th fret and bar all the way across, asking a lot of our first finger.

D Dominant 7

  • Finally, we have the dominant seventh chord.

  • Chord: D dominant 7 on the A string

  • Shape Count: 1, 2, 3, 4

  • Alternative Voicing:

    • If we wanted that with the root note on the E string, we'll be up on the 10th fret playing the E shape here.
